GDPR Compliance
On May 25, 2018, the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) came into effect in the European Union (EU). The GDPR expands privacy rights for EU individuals and imposes new obligations on companies like Lawxy that market to, process, or store EU personal data.
If you are located in the European Union, this section applies to you.
For the purposes of this GDPR Privacy Notice, “Personal Data” and “processing” have the meanings given to them under the GDPR. Generally, Personal Data means information that can identify an individual, and processing refers to actions performed on data such as collection, use, storage, and disclosure.
Lawxy acts as the data controller for Personal Data processed in connection with its services, except where we process Personal Data on behalf of customers’ end users or employees. In such cases, Lawxy acts as a data processor, and the customer is the data controller.
For questions regarding data rights or processing activities where Lawxy is the controller, please contact praket@lawxyai.com. Where Lawxy acts as a processor, please contact the relevant controller in the first instance.
This GDPR Privacy Notice supplements our general Privacy Policy. In case of any conflict, the provision that offers greater protection to Personal Data shall prevail.
Lawful Basis for Processing
We process Personal Data only where we have a lawful basis, including:
Your consent
Performance of a contract
Compliance with legal obligations
Legitimate interests, provided they do not override your rights
Where processing is based on consent, this will be clearly indicated at the time of data collection. We may also process Personal Data where required to protect vital interests, comply with the law, or perform tasks in the public interest.
